AT&T Hosting & Application Services is currently seeking a talented, highly professional individual to join our growing team. The ideal candidate should possess 5 years experience deploying and troubleshooting complex hosted SharePoint and Windows solutions in a high profile multi-client environment. As a SharePoint Administrator / Systems Engineer, this individual acts as a member of multiple project teams focused on delivering and migrating complex systems into AT&T's world class hosted infrastructure for our Fortune 500 customers. The successful engineer will play an integral role in designing and delivering enterprise SharePoint solutions for our customers. This individual will also contribute in the research and development of our service offerings surrounding SharePoint 2010 as well as evaluating complementary products such as migration and administrative tools. Responsible for translating business needs into technical solutions, and defining solutions to problems through reasoned application of information technology. Designs, develops, documents and analyzes overall architecture of systems, including hardware and software. Determines integrated hardware and software architecture solutions that meet performance, usability, scalability, reliability, and security needs. Coordinates design and integration of total system including subsystems. Researches and recommends technology to improve the current systems.
